Don't Get Burned: Identifying Fake Forex Brokers

Diving into the world of forex trading can be intriguing, but beware of pitfalls lurking in the shadows. A plethora of phony brokers exist, eager to deceive unsuspecting traders. To safeguard yourself from these schemes, it's crucial to develop a keen eye for identifying red flags.

First and foremost, always undertake thorough research on any broker before depositing. Scrutinize their credentials, ensure they are authorized by reputable bodies. A legitimate broker will openly disclose their fees and financial instruments offered.

  • Beware brokers who promise unrealistic gains or guaranteed success.
  • Look for independent reviews from other traders to gauge their credibility.
  • Remember that if a deal seems too good to be true, it most likely is.

Identifying Fake Brokers: A Guide to Online Trading Safety

Stepping into the dynamic world of online trading can be exciting, but it's crucial to exercise caution when choosing a broker. Unfortunately, the arena is rife with fraudulent entities seeking to exploit unsuspecting investors. To protect yourself from these serious threats, it's essential to hone a keen eye for spotting fake brokers. Begin by carefully researching any broker before investing your funds.

  • Analyze their website for professionalism. Look for clear contact information, a robust "About Us" section, and regulatory statements.
  • Confirm their registration with relevant financial authorities. A legitimate broker will be openly displaying these certifications.
  • Beware of promises of guaranteed returns, as this is a classic red flag of dishonest activities.

Evade Financial Disaster: Understanding Broker Review Scams

Savvy investors know the importance of thorough research before entrusting their hard-earned money to any brokerage firm. Sadly, the online world is rife with fraudulent schemes aiming to entice unsuspecting individuals into disastrous financial situations. One particularly insidious tactic involves phony broker review sites that present rosy portrayals of firms that may be anything but legitimate. These sites often harness sneaky tactics to persuade readers, making it essential for investors to hone a discerning eye when perusing the vast sea of online information.

  • Remain vigilant of review sites that present only overwhelmingly favorable reviews.
  • Scrutinize the authors of reviews – do they any evident affiliations to the brokerage firm in question?
  • Seek out independent sources for corroboration of the claims made on review sites.

Remember – your financial health is at stake. Take the time to carry out due diligence and escape potentially harmful scams.
